Permanent/Full Time 37 hours per week.
A fantastic opportunity has arisen for a motivated and ambitious project or progamme manager to play a key role in delivering Bristol City Council’s capital portfolio.
You’ll work within the Councils Capital Programme Management Office supporting the Head of Capital Projects to build high performing project and programme teams, monitor and maintain performance and coordinate Management Information and portfolio reporting.
You will work collaboratively to develop briefs, manage stakeholders, analyse commercial proposals, navigate decision pathways and provide support to the Programme Management Office to mobilise and deliver complex schemes across sectors.
What do I need to have?
You will have or be already or on the path to a professional level qualification and be committed to continued personal development. Experience of managing multi-disciplinary teams on major capital projects is important. You will have a good understanding of the Local Authority context and be confident working within a political environment.
You will also demonstrate success on large capital projects, stakeholder management and managing complex budgets. You will be able to show innovation and the capacity to build high performing diverse teams.
